- Q: How can one determine the correct pressure and flow rating for hydraulic components in concrete pump spare parts?
- To determine the correct pressure and flow rating for hydraulic components in concrete pump spare parts, one must consider the specific requirements and specifications of the concrete pump system. This involves understanding the maximum pressure and flow requirements of the pump, as well as considering factors such as the type and size of the concrete being pumped, the distance and height of the pumping operation, and any additional attachments or accessories being used. It is crucial to consult the manufacturer's guidelines and recommendations, as well as seek advice from hydraulic experts, to ensure the hydraulic components are properly selected for optimal performance and efficiency.
- Q: How often should a hopper filter be cleaned or replaced?
- The frequency at which a hopper filter should be cleaned or replaced depends on various factors such as the type of hopper, the nature of contaminants, and the usage pattern. As a general guideline, it is recommended to clean or replace the hopper filter at least once every three to six months. However, if the hopper is used in a particularly dusty or dirty environment, or if it handles materials that produce a high level of debris, more frequent cleaning or replacement may be necessary. Regular inspection of the hopper filter is crucial to determine the accumulation of particles and the effectiveness of filtration. Additionally, if the hopper filter starts to show signs of damage or wear, it should be replaced immediately to maintain optimal performance and prevent any potential contamination. Ultimately, it is advisable to refer to the manufacturer's guidelines and recommendations for the specific hopper filter being used.
- Q: What are the signs of a faulty concrete pump control box?
- Signs of a faulty concrete pump control box can vary depending on the specific issue. However, there are some common indicators to look out for: 1. Unresponsive controls: When the controls fail to function properly or become unresponsive, such as buttons not working or switches not engaging, it is a clear sign of a faulty control box. 2. Inaccurate readings: If the readings or measurements displayed on the control panel are inconsistent or incorrect, such as pressure readings or flow rates, it suggests a faulty control box. 3. Electrical problems: Faulty control boxes can cause electrical issues like flickering lights, sudden power surges or shortages, and blown fuses. These electrical problems can be dangerous and potentially cause further damage. 4. Strange noises: A faulty control box may produce unusual noises like buzzing, humming, or clicking sounds. These noises indicate loose connections, damaged components, or malfunctioning parts within the control box. 5. Pump malfunctions: The concrete pump itself can experience malfunctions due to a faulty control box. This can include inconsistent pumping, irregular flow, or sudden stops and starts, which can disrupt the concrete pouring process and lead to project delays. If you suspect a faulty concrete pump control box, it is crucial to address the issue promptly. It is recommended to seek assistance from a qualified technician or contact the manufacturer for help in diagnosing and repairing the control box.
- Q: How is a concrete pump pipe different from a regular pipe?
- A concrete pump pipe is specifically designed to be used in concrete pumping applications, whereas a regular pipe is more commonly used for general plumbing purposes. Concrete pump pipes are typically made of high-quality and durable materials to withstand the high pressure and abrasive nature of pumped concrete. They also have specialized ends, such as flanges or couplings, to provide a secure connection between the pump and the delivery system. In contrast, regular pipes may come in various materials and sizes, depending on their intended use in plumbing systems.
- Q: Are there any specific troubleshooting steps for identifying issues with concrete pump spare parts?
- Yes, there are specific troubleshooting steps that can be followed to identify issues with concrete pump spare parts. 1. Visual Inspection: Conduct a thorough visual inspection of the spare parts, looking for any signs of wear, damage, or misalignment. Check for cracks, breaks, or any other visible signs of damage. 2. Functionality Test: Test the functionality of the spare parts by operating the concrete pump. Pay attention to any abnormal noises, vibrations, or irregular movements. This can help identify issues with the spare parts. 3. Pressure Test: Perform a pressure test to ensure that the spare parts can handle the required pressure. This can be done by connecting a pressure gauge to the pump and checking if it reaches the desired pressure levels. Any abnormal pressure fluctuations can indicate issues with the spare parts. 4. Flow Test: Conduct a flow test to evaluate the flow rate of the concrete through the pump. Check if the flow is consistent and smooth. Any blockages or irregular flow patterns can indicate issues with the spare parts. 5. Check for Leaks: Inspect the spare parts for any leaks or fluid seepage. Leaks can indicate faulty seals, gaskets, or fittings. Use a suitable leak detection method, such as using a dye or pressure test, to identify the source of the leak. 6. Consult Technical Manuals: Refer to the technical manuals provided by the manufacturer for troubleshooting guidelines specific to the concrete pump spare parts. These manuals often contain detailed troubleshooting steps and recommended solutions for common issues. 7. Seek Expert Advice: If you are unable to identify the issue or troubleshoot effectively, it is advisable to consult with a qualified technician or the manufacturer's technical support team. They can provide expert guidance and assistance in identifying and resolving complex issues with concrete pump spare parts. By following these troubleshooting steps, it becomes easier to identify any issues with concrete pump spare parts and take appropriate measures to address them promptly.

- Q: How often should agitator shaft seals be replaced in a concrete pump?
- The frequency at which agitator shaft seals should be replaced in a concrete pump depends on several factors such as the type and quality of the seal, the operational conditions of the pump, and the maintenance practices followed by the user. However, as a general guideline, it is recommended to inspect and replace agitator shaft seals in a concrete pump every 500 to 1,000 operating hours or annually, whichever comes first. Regular inspection of the seals is crucial to identify any signs of wear, leakage, or damage. If any of these issues are detected, immediate replacement is necessary to prevent further damage to the pump and ensure optimal performance. Additionally, it is essential to follow the manufacturer's recommendations and guidelines regarding seal replacements, as they may provide specific instructions based on the pump model and seal type. Proper maintenance practices, including regular cleaning and lubrication of the seals, can also extend their lifespan and reduce the need for frequent replacements. It is important to keep in mind that failure to replace worn or damaged agitator shaft seals in a timely manner can lead to increased downtime, decreased efficiency, and potential damage to other components of the concrete pump. Hence, it is crucial to prioritize regular inspection and replacement of agitator shaft seals to ensure the smooth operation and longevity of the concrete pump.
